  24. The perennial problem continues and its disappointing that we haven't brought in the quality of sound engineer to sort the problem. But let's not pretend it's an easy fix. Tannoy systems in outdoor stadiums are much harder to set up than in indoor arenas and anyone who's been to concerts will know how the sound quality can vary there. Many factors affect performance and how the stands are open to the elements, the infrastructure from which the sound may bounce off and the numbers in the stadium are just some of them. If you've ever seen a gig at the Colston Hall you will have witnessed how the sound quality can differ between a half full auditorium for the support band the the full house for the main act. Equally, how open or closed in a, stadium may be can significantly affect sound quality. Many other football grounds have rubbish tannoy systems too.
